Output 73f067d33cde4a0030b1c1b50e10b8a70c7938e7e95a4bc2e3ad171199f7fce3:17

value
579393214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c156092a8a02d14d5fc87cb37c2ad861c3430c OP_EQUAL
address
32VJwJcmYuBJ8Rkcp7wNxtLsXCvXusHQAp
transaction
73f067d33cde4a0030b1c1b50e10b8a70c7938e7e95a4bc2e3ad171199f7fce3
spent
true